Myelin
A fatty substance that insulates the axon and allows it to send nerve impulses quickly.
Schwann cells
Specialized cells located in the peripheral nervous system, responsible for the formation of myelin sheaths around neurons, facilitating rapid signal transmission.
Axons
Long threadlike part of a nerve cell along which impulses are conducted from the cell body to other cells.
Myelinated axons
Nerve fibers covered in myelin, a protective sheath that speeds up the transmission of electrical signals in the nervous system.
